How do I change my address with USPS online?

Published in Mail Forwarding 2 mins read

To change your address with the United States Postal Service (USPS) online, you can easily submit your new information and verify your identity through their official website.

Step-by-Step Guide to Changing Your Address with USPS Online

Changing your mailing address with USPS online is a secure and convenient process that ensures your mail is redirected to your new location. Follow these steps to update your address:

  1. Visit the Official USPS Change of Address® Website:
    Begin by navigating to the Official USPS Change of Address® website. This dedicated online portal is where you will initiate your move request.

  2. Select Your Move Type and Complete the Form:
    Once on the website, you will need to choose the category that best describes your move and then proceed to fill out the online form. The options typically include:

    Move Type Description
    Individual For a single person moving to a new address.
    Family When everyone moving shares the same last name and is relocating together.
    Business For commercial entities or organizations changing their mailing address.

    After selecting your specific move type, meticulously complete the online form with all necessary details, including your old and new addresses, and the effective date of your move.

  3. Verify Your Identity:
    As a crucial security measure, you must verify your identity online. This typically involves opting to receive a verification code or a secure link on your mobile phone. Follow the on-screen instructions to confirm your identity, which helps protect your mail and prevent fraudulent address changes.

Important Considerations

  • A small fee is usually associated with changing your address online, primarily to cover identity verification costs and deter fraud.
  • After submission, you will receive a confirmation email detailing your change of address request.
  • Mail forwarding services generally commence a few days after your specified start date.
